This article provides an overview of the species composition of the phylum Nemertea in the Far Eastern seas of Russia. The list of nemerteans includes at least 200 species from the classes Palaeonemertea, Pilidiophora, and Hoplonemertea. Many of the species proved to be new to science; most of them remain undescribed. Currently, the use of gene markers is often the only approach to discriminating between closely related species and identifying them accurately. The well-studied nemertean fauna of Peter the Great Bay (73 species), Sea of Japan, has become a basis for comprehensive studies of these invertebrates at the Zhirmunsky National Scientific Center of Marine Biology, Far Eastern Branch, Russian Academy of Sciences.
